2009's trip to Fontana Village in Fontana, NC was awesome as usual. We've played Fontana 4 years now and they've asked us back next year. It's one of the best times of the year. The whole band couldn't go this year but we had Philip Poff fill in on some vocals and guitar and also Drew Williams sat in on fiddle and vocals. The show went really well. The folks that put on the clogging jamboree are some of the best people to work for. They are good friends of ours and we want to thank them for the opportunity to play for their event. The Oak Ridge Boys show went really well. The crowd was great and RD sang bass on an acapella gospel number for the first time in front of a big audience. We got to jam a little bit with Joe Bonsall. We got to play a little Salt Creek, with Joe on banjo, before our sound check. We also got to talk some with their band, all of which were super nice guys especially Chris Golden. We also got to take a group photo with the Oak Ridge Boys. They really put on a good show. We hope to work with them again some day.

We are currently in the studio working on the second Grass Stains cd. We have many songs to choose from including several originals as well as some familiar rock songs and traditional bluegrass. We will be adding these songs to our setlist as we work them up so be sure and catch a performance near you to get a preview of the new cd.
